Note alarm
The phone beeps and displays the note.
With a call note
the displayed number, press the call key.
To stop the alarm and to view the note,
select View. To stop the alarm for 10
minutes, select Snooze.
To stop the alarm without viewing the
note, select Exit.

To view a note, scroll to it, and select
View.
You can also select an option to delete
the selected note and delete all the notes
that you have marked as done. You can
sort the notes by priority or by deadline,
send a note to another phone as a text
message or a multimedia message, save a
note as a calendar note, or access the
calendar.
While viewing a note, you can also select
an option to edit the deadline or priority
for the note, or mark the note as done.

Other options include deleting and
editing a note. While editing a note, you
can also exit the text editor without
saving the changes. You can send the
note to compatible devices through
infrared, Bluetooth wireless technology,
text message, or a multimedia message.
If the note is too long to be sent as a text
message, the phone asks you to delete
the appropriate number of characters
from your note.
